2011 Chevy Malibu 2lt - transmission slipping between 1st and 2nd gears, also 2nd to 3rd. Takes a dangerously long time for it to kick in to the correct gear and I have had some close calls pulling into traffic. Also, this six speed transmission is defective when trying to pass another vehicle as once you are in 6th gear, it will not drop to 5th in order to pass. The rpms race up and nothing happens. All of this and GM says that the vehicle is operating as normal and there is no problem. Obviously there is. This is a defect and needs to be replaced. Multiple discussion forums online describe the same problem with this model year and also 2010 1lt and 2tl 4cyl and 6cyl. Something needs to be done and GM is not doing it. Help!!
